Biography
Research Interests:- Renaissance drama and prose
- Shakespeare
- gender and genre studies
- cultural materialist theory and criticism
- Editor, Thomas Dekker: Lantern and Candlelight (1608). Toronto: Centre for Reformation and Renaissance Studies, University of Toronto, 2007
- Enacting Gender on the English Renaissance Stage>, co-edited with Anne Russell. Urbana and Chicago: University of Illinois Press, 1999
- Discontinuities: New Essays on Renaissance Literature and Criticism, co-edited with Paul Stevens. Toronto: University of Toronto Press, 1998
- 'Household Business': Domestic Plays of Early Modern England. Toronto: University of Toronto Press, 1997
- "'A Kind of Music': The Representation of Cant in Early Modern Rogue Literature," Language and Otherness in Renaissance Culture: Selected and Expanded Papers from the 2006 International Conference on Early Modern Cartographies of Difference (Paris: Presses Universitaires de Paris)
- "Subjectivity, Theory, and Early Modern Drama," Early Theatre 7.2 (2004)
- "Dekker's The Honest Whore, Part II, Drama Criticism 12 (Spring 2000)
- "Music, The Book of the Courtier, and Othello's Soldiership," in The Italian World of English Renaissance Drama: Cultural Exchange and Intertextuality (University of Delaware Press, 1998)
- "Merchants and Madcaps: Dekker's Honest Whore Plays and the Commedia dell'Arte," in Shakespeare's Italy: Functions of Italian Locations in Renaissance Drama (Manchester University Press, 1997)
- "Murder at Home: Domestic Tragedy in the Renaissance," Modern Language Association of America Radio Program: What's the Word 157 (Spring 2004)
